The median household income in Lakeside Village, OK is $49,018, which is 33.1% below the national average of $73,224. Per capita income is $35,709. The poverty rate of 9.8% is lower than the OK state average of 18.5%. The Gini index of income inequality is 0.2807, where 0 represents perfect equality and 1 represents maximum inequality. The unemployment rate is 0.0%, compared to the state average of 5.0%. 0.0%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The average commute time is 19 minutes, with 51.9% working from home.
